Should Bolt Hole On Leaf Spring Hanger Be Larger Than Shackle Bolt  

Updated 09/19/2024 | Published 09/13/2024

Question:

The hole in the shackle for the bolt that attaches the spring to the shackle is larger than 9/16. I know i need to replace the bushing and the 9/16 x 3 1/2 bolt. Is this normal for this hole to be this large.

Expert Reply:

Hey Paul; it looks like the bolt hole has been elongated/enlarged from use over time. This is something that can happen from standard suspension wear. It should match the 9/16" bolt. With the hole being that large I would say it is time to replace the hangers before the hanger, or something else, fails from all the extra unwanted movement.

You want to stick with the same height for hangers so you will need to measure to find a replacement. The height is the distance from the center of the bolt hole to the top of the hanger.
